Pakistan Police File Abduction Case Against Jinn After 11-Year-Old Disappears

In Rawalpindi, police have taken the strange step of filing an abduction case against a jinn after an 11-year-old boy vanished. The boy’s father claims supernatural spirits forced his son to run away. Similar cases involving jinn have appeared before in Pakistan's courts.

Laura Fernández Wins Costa Rica Presidency, Vows Tough Fight Against Drug Violence

Rightwing populist Laura Fernández wins Costa Rica's presidential election with 48.3% vote, pledging a hard crackdown on drug trade violence. Her victory marks a shift in Latin America’s politics.

Brave 13-Year-Old Swims 4km to Rescue Family Off Australia Coast

A 13-year-old boy heroically swam 4km through rough waters to save his mother and siblings stranded at sea in Australia. Facing danger, he ditched his life jacket to last longer. His courage triggered a rescue that saved the family near Geographe Bay.

Balochistan Sees Sharpened Violence as BLA Launches 'Operation Herof 2.0'

The Baloch Liberation Army launched 'Operation Herof 2.0' with coordinated attacks across Balochistan. Pakistan responds with a fierce counterstrike, killing over 130 militants amid rising tensions in the region.

Australian Woman Dies After Getting Trapped in Ski Lift at Japan Resort

A 22-year-old Australian woman died after her backpack got caught on a ski lift at Tsugaike Mountain Resort, Japan. She suffered a heart attack and was declared dead at the hospital. Officials have apologized and launched an investigation.
